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

We describe an AI-enabled, integrated Coronavirus drug discovery knowledgebase, free for the research community. Its goal is to make accessible up to date information relevant to drug discovery for SARS-CoV-2 and other coronaviruses. It builds on great knowledge from across therapeutic areas and provides unbiased, systematic, objective information to empower the international effort.
